You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@stanbol.apache.org by "Rupert Westenthaler (JIRA)" <ji...@apache.org> on 2013/04/19 12:25:15 UTC

[jira] [Resolved] (STANBOL-1044) Avoid use of org.json

     [ https://issues.apache.org/jira/browse/STANBOL-1044?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

Rupert Westenthaler resolved STANBOL-1044.
------------------------------------------

    Resolution: Not A Problem
      Assignee: Rupert Westenthaler

Apache Stanbol does only transitively depend on org.json via the Apache Felix Webconsole.

The org.json module is not part of the stanbol parent pom.xml and also not in any other sub modules pom.

To make make the transitive dependency to org.json more clear the dependency was moved to the osgiframework bundlelist with http://svn.apache.org/r1469770
                
> Avoid use of org.json
> ---------------------
>
>                 Key: STANBOL-1044
>                 URL: https://issues.apache.org/jira/browse/STANBOL-1044
>             Project: Stanbol
>          Issue Type: Bug
>            Reporter: Sebastian Schaffert
>            Assignee: Rupert Westenthaler
>
> The org.json library is considered "discriminatory", because its license clause states that the software "may not be used for evil". While the ASF for the moment still accepts its use (see legal FAQ), it is still discouraged because it might cause problems for end users. The org.json library use should therefore be replaced by Jackson.

--
This message is automatically generated by JIRA.
If you think it was sent incorrectly, please contact your JIRA administrators
For more information on JIRA, see: http://www.atlassian.com/software/jira